Former Bills OLB Von Miller confirmed he will “definitely” play in 2025, but is uncertain about which team he will join, noting that the Broncos have shown no interest in a reunion due to their current roster. Miller, a former first-round pick by the Broncos, had a lucrative career, including a six-year, $120 million deal with the Bills, but was released to save cap space after a season where he recorded 17 tackles and six sacks.
